Castle Gardens in North Belfast takes its name from its proximity to Belfast Castle which was built in 1870. Resolved - That the names ‘Castle Gardens’ and ‘Olympia Parade’ be approved for new streets off Donegall Park Avenue and Tate’s Avenue respectively, on the property of Messrs. H. and J. Martin, Ltd. (IC, 12th January 1937). “On the recommendation of the city surveyor, the committee approved of the following street names submitted by the estate Superintendent for streets off Donegal Park Ave: Waveney Ave, Waveney Park, Waveney Drive, Waveney Grove, Fairhill Park, Fairhill Way.
